Aperçu

CVE-2026-84641 is an information disclosure vulnerability in Mozilla Thunderbird caused by a use-after-free condition triggered by a malicious IMAP server response. When Thunderbird connects to a rogue IMAP server, the server can send a crafted ID response that causes heap-memory contents to be disclosed and potentially persisted to the user's prefs.js file. The vulnerability was disclosed on September 1, 2026, and affects Thunderbird versions prior to 155, 140.15 (ESR), and 153.2 (ESR). It is rated low impact by Mozilla and estimated as Medium severity by Feedly; an official CVSS score had not been published at time of writing (Mozilla Advisory MFSA2026-86, Mozilla Advisory MFSA2026-87, Mozilla Advisory MFSA2026-88).

Détails techniques

The root cause is classified as CWE-825 (Expired Pointer Dereference), manifesting as a use-after-free when Thunderbird processes a crafted IMAP ID command response from a server it is connected to. The freed heap memory is subsequently read and its contents can be written to the user's prefs.js preferences file, enabling persistent exfiltration of sensitive heap data. Exploitation requires the victim's Thunderbird client to connect to an attacker-controlled or compromised IMAP server — either by tricking the user into configuring a malicious account or by performing a man-in-the-middle attack on an existing IMAP connection. The bug was reported by researcher ABDULAZIZ ALASAIQAH and tracked internally as Mozilla Bug 2057805 (Mozilla Advisory MFSA2026-86, Red Hat Bugzilla).

Impact

Successful exploitation results in disclosure of heap memory contents from the Thunderbird process, which may include sensitive data such as credentials, session tokens, or other in-memory secrets. These heap contents can be persisted to the prefs.js file on disk, potentially allowing an attacker with subsequent file-system access to retrieve the disclosed data. The vulnerability does not directly enable remote code execution or privilege escalation, and its impact is limited to confidentiality (Mozilla Advisory MFSA2026-86, Mozilla Advisory MFSA2026-88).

Exploitabilité

No public proof-of-concept exploit code or in-the-wild exploitation has been reported for CVE-2026-84641 as of the disclosure date. The EPSS score is 0.0, indicating a very low probability of near-term exploitation. The vulnerability is not listed in the CISA Known Exploited Vulnerabilities (KEV) catalog. Exploitation requires the attacker to control or impersonate an IMAP server that the victim connects to, raising the bar for opportunistic attacks (Feedly, Red Hat Bugzilla).

Étapes d’exploitation

  1. Set up a malicious IMAP server: The attacker deploys a rogue IMAP server (e.g., using a custom server or modified open-source IMAP daemon) capable of sending a crafted ID command response.
  2. Lure or redirect the victim: The attacker either tricks the victim into configuring Thunderbird to connect to the malicious server (e.g., via phishing), or performs a man-in-the-middle attack on an existing IMAP connection (e.g., via ARP spoofing or DNS hijacking on a local network).
  3. Send crafted ID response: Upon connection, the malicious server sends a specially crafted IMAP ID response that triggers a use-after-free condition in Thunderbird's IMAP handling code.
  4. Heap memory disclosure: The freed heap memory is read by Thunderbird, exposing potentially sensitive in-memory data.
  5. Persistence to prefs.js: Thunderbird writes the disclosed heap contents into the user's prefs.js file on disk.
  6. Exfiltrate data: The attacker retrieves the prefs.js file (e.g., via a subsequent file-access vector, social engineering, or if the server interaction itself allows data to be sent back) to extract the disclosed heap contents (Mozilla Advisory MFSA2026-86, Red Hat Bugzilla).

Indicateurs de compromis

  • Network: Thunderbird connections to unexpected or newly configured IMAP servers, particularly on non-standard ports or with self-signed certificates; unusual IMAP ID command/response traffic captured in network logs.
  • File System: Unexpected or anomalous content in the Thunderbird profile's prefs.js file (e.g., binary-looking or garbled strings in preference values); recent modification timestamps on prefs.js coinciding with IMAP session activity.
  • Logs: Thunderbird error logs or crash reports referencing IMAP ID response parsing; operating system logs showing Thunderbird writing to prefs.js at unusual times.

Atténuation et solutions de contournement

Mozilla has released patched versions that address CVE-2026-84641: Thunderbird 155, Thunderbird ESR 140.15, and Thunderbird ESR 153.2. Users should update to one of these versions immediately. No configuration-based workaround has been published; the recommended action is to upgrade. As an additional precaution, users should avoid connecting Thunderbird to untrusted or unknown IMAP servers and ensure IMAP connections use TLS to reduce man-in-the-middle risk (Mozilla Advisory MFSA2026-86, Mozilla Advisory MFSA2026-87, Mozilla Advisory MFSA2026-88).

Réactions de la communauté

Mozilla rated this vulnerability as low impact in all three security advisories published on September 1, 2026, noting that scripting-based flaws generally cannot be exploited through email in Thunderbird. Red Hat opened a high-priority security tracking bug (Bug 2527115) for downstream package maintainers. No notable independent researcher commentary or significant social media discussion has been identified beyond standard vulnerability aggregator coverage (Mozilla Advisory MFSA2026-86, Red Hat Bugzilla).
